How can I cover my tooth?

Published in Dental Restorations 1 min read

You can cover your tooth using a dental crown or a veneer, each serving different purposes.

Dental Crowns vs. Veneers

The choice between a dental crown and a veneer depends on your specific needs and goals.

  • Dental Crown: A dental crown fits over your entire tooth.
  • Veneer: A veneer is a thin porcelain shell that covers the front surface of your tooth.

Choosing the Right Option

  • Cosmetic Purposes: If you are primarily concerned with the appearance of your tooth, a veneer might be the better option. According to the reference material, veneers are cosmetic in nature.
  • Extensive Damage: If your tooth has extensive damage or decay, a dental crown might be necessary to provide structural support and protection.

In summary, the best way to cover your tooth depends on whether you need a cosmetic solution or a more comprehensive restoration. Consult with your dentist to determine the most appropriate option for your situation.
